Transaction 5fad86cfca93d770ff6561835166617dbb2428e9d777660a5da88261091d7795
1 Input
1 Output
-
5fad86cfca93d770ff6561835166617dbb2428e9d777660a5da88261091d7795:0
- value
- 1458849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c44223b5bfcc0f0ef5b51643726bb1ab70f382c OP_EQUAL
- address
- 3Qgspu5fqTZKBhhSBAsutd3GFxVXbwLnfh